Short Ribs Dutch Oven Recipe

For a delicious and easy dinner, try this short ribs Dutch oven recipe. Short ribs are a great cut of meat to use in a variety of recipes, and this one is no exception. The Dutch oven helps to create a flavorful and tender dish that will soon become a family favorite.

Ingredients:

• 3-4 pounds of bone-in beef short ribs

• 1 large onion, diced

• 3 cloves of garlic, minced

• 2 tablespoons of olive oil

• 2 tablespoons of tomato paste

• 1 tablespoon of Worcestershire sauce

• 2 cups of beef stock

• 1 teaspoon of dried rosemary

• 1 teaspoon of dried oregano

• 1 bay leaf

•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ions:

1. Preheat the oven to 375°F.

2. Heat the olive oil in a large Dutch oven over medium-high heat.

3. Add the short ribs to the Dutch oven and brown them on all sides.

4. Remove the short ribs from the Dutch oven and set aside.

5. Add the onions and garlic to the Dutch oven and cook until soft, about 5 minutes.

6. Add the tomato paste and Worcestershire sauce and cook for another 2 minutes.

7. Add the beef stock, rosemary, oregano, bay leaf, and salt and pepper.

8. Return the short ribs to the Dutch oven, cover, and bake in the oven for 2-3 hours, or until the meat is tender.

9. Serve the short ribs with your favorite sides and enjoy.
